Security checks: confirm archived objects are unreadable via the public tier, manifests are signed, and deletion requires dual approval. Negative tests include forged manifest rejection and expired-lock tampering attempts. All runs occur in the Saltmere isolation environment; no production buckets touched. Estimated duration: two days. The archiver's service account in Saltmere authenticates with the token below.

session JWT of yawep-yawep = eyJhbGciOiJIUzI1NiIsInR5cCI6IkpXVCJ9.eyJzdWIiOiI3pWF3_In0.aXYsHiog

Alert: DIGEST_SCHEDULER_SKEW on Mailloft. This fires when the batch email digest scheduler drifts more than 20 minutes from its configured send window. Usually it's one of two things: the cron shard got rebalanced mid-window, or a big tenant's digest build is hogging the queue. Users notice fast — digests landing at 3am instead of 8am generates tickets. Don't ship a release while this is firing; the scheduler restart invalidates in-flight batches. Runbook steps and the pause-and-drain procedure are on the page below.

dashboard of yafog-fajof = https://jira.tolvaqsys.internal/pages/pages/projects/49fe21c4

## Configuration: Health Checks

Grovegate sits behind a load balancer that polls `/healthz` every five seconds. Plugins must not block this endpoint; heavy checks belong on `/readyz`, which is polled less often. A plugin failing readiness drains traffic from the node but does not restart it. The balancer authenticates health probes with a shared credential, which you must set in the env file on this line:

env line for yahip-tafog: RELAY_SECRET3=4ca

## Support

Dedupe-Owl collapses duplicate pages before they reach the on-call rotation. For bugs, check the open issues list first; most flapping-alert reports are configuration problems, not code defects. Patches should include a test case reproducing the duplicate pattern. For anything urgent or security-related, contact the maintainers directly at the address below.

escalation mailbox, yafog-kafof: eliok@xolmarcloud.local